CopiaFacts provides a number of different ways to prevent sending faxes or e-mails to specific numbers or addresses.  The original dBASE index lookup files are supported by all versions, and from CopiaFacts engine release 7.230 with F7DATABASE.DLL version 7.221, a wide range of standard databases are supported for looking up the items to be excluded.

From April 2009, a new method of processing Do-Not-Send checking has been implemented in the Job Administration launcher and in FFBC.  This offers the following advantages:

Greater efficiency because the files are checked centrally during launch
Significantly reduced network load and contention by not checking index files from all lines/threads.
Earlier detection of matches, eliminating wasted processing such as document conversion.
The ability to specify white-lists of numbers to be excluded from checking for specific clients
The ability to record a code with the index entry to report, for example, on the source of the entry
Customized outcome codes can be specified to be applied to matches from each list.

It is planned that this processing method will be extended to cover Do-Not-Send checking in the COPIAFACTS engine in a future release.

Legacy Do-Not-Send lookup can be done both globally and for specific user profiles (.USR) or broadcast jobs (.UJP).  When both global lookup and user-specific lookup are specified, a number or e-mail address will be excluded if it appears in either index.
